大于变量个数是不可能的,因子分析计算上其实是矩阵对角化,对角阵与原协方差阵是相似的,因此阶数一定是相等的,故C错。若因子个数等于变量个数,很容易会出现载荷很低的无效因子,故B错。D不严谨,故错
                    正确答案是:A: 小于变量个数
专业分析:
因子分析是一种数据降维技术,旨在通过少数几个因子来解释原始数据中变量之间的相关结构。通常情况下,提取的因子数应小于变量个数,具体原因如下:
1. **数据简化**:因子分析的主要目的是简化数据结构,将多个相关变量归纳为少数几个因子。如果提取的因子数等于或大于变量个数,就失去了简化数据的意义。
2. **解释力**:通常情况下,研究者会选择能够解释大部分方差的少数几个因子,而不是提取所有可能的因子。这样可以更有效地解释数据背后的主要结构。
3. **统计方法**:在实际操作中,常用的方法(如Kaiser准则或碎石图法)也会建议提取因子数小于变量个数,以确保因子的解释力和简洁性。
因此,提取的因子数一般要求小于变量个数。